Q

Rules for “Star Spangled Banner” and “Hail to the Chief”

A
  1. The US Navy Arrangement of the “Star Spangled Banner” and the US Marine Band arrangement of “Hail to the Chief” are designated as the official DoD arrangements to be rendered by all Service Bands on appropriate occasions

2.”Hail to the Chief” is designated as a musical tribute to the President of the US and may not be performed by military musical organizations as a tribute to other dignitaries

  1. During all renditions of “Hail to the Chief” by military musical units, military personnel in uniform, other than band personnel, will accord it the same military honor as they would rendition of the “Star Spangled Banner”
  2. If, in the course of any ceremony, it is required that honors be performed more than once, “Hail to the Chief” may be used interchangeably with the “Star Spangled Banner” as honors to the President of the US
  3. When specified by the President, the Secretary of State, the Chief of the Secret Service, or their authorized representatives, “Hail to the Chief” may be used as an opportunity for the President and his or her immediate party to move or from their places while all others stand fast

Q

What procedures must embassies requesting DoD support must follow?

A

1.) US Embassies may request support directly from US Military units stationed locally in their vicinity

2.) US Embassies in nations located in the geographic AOR of a CCMD must submit all requests for musical or ceremonial support to the respective CCMD PAO

3.) Ceremonial performances by CONUS-based units that are operationally controlled by their respective CCMD must adhere to guidance in Paragraph 6.3 of Volume 1 and Paragraph 4.5 of this volume

Q

What are the policies for Foreign National Anthems?

A

1.) US Military Bands are authorized to perform foreign national anthems at official civil ceremonies within CONUS only when one or more senior government representatives of those foreign nations are actively participating in the ceremony and the representatives holds a rank that entitles them to receive official US Government honors.

2.) Only foreign national anthems of participating countries may be played during international sporting events, such as the Pan American Games or the International Olympics, in which the US ia participant
